Use frozen fish sticks

Yes, you can cook frozen fish sticks in an air fryer! It's a quick and easy method that will give you crispy fish sticks with a juicy center. Here's a step-by-step guide:

Preheat Your Air Fryer:

First, preheat your air fryer. Set the temperature to between 390°F and 400°F (200°C-205°C). Most sources recommend 400°F. If your air fryer doesn't have a preheat setting, simply turn it on and let it run empty for a few minutes at the desired temperature. Preheating ensures even cooking and a crispy texture.

Prepare the Fish Sticks:

Take your favorite brand of frozen fish sticks out of the freezer. You don't need to thaw them first. Place the fish sticks in a single layer at the bottom of the air fryer basket or on a tray. Make sure they don't overlap and that there is some space between them for the air to circulate, ensuring even cooking.

Optional: Use Cooking Spray:

You can choose to lightly spray or brush the air fryer basket or the tops of the fish sticks with a non-stick cooking spray. This will help to prevent sticking and promote crispiness. However, this step is optional, as some people prefer not to use cooking spray.

Air Fry the Fish Sticks:

Close the lid of the air fryer and set the timer. The cooking time will vary slightly depending on the brand of fish sticks and your air fryer, but generally, it should take around 9-12 minutes for the fish sticks to cook. Flip the fish sticks halfway through the cooking time to ensure even crispiness on both sides.

Serve and Enjoy:

Once the fish sticks are golden and crispy, remove them from the air fryer. Serve them with lemon wedges and your favorite dipping sauce, such as tartar sauce, ketchup, barbecue sauce, or ranch dip. Enjoy!

Tips and Tricks:

  • Each brand of fish sticks may vary in size and thickness, so you might need to adjust the cooking time accordingly.
  • If your fish sticks are particularly thick, or your air fryer runs cooler, you can try reducing the temperature and cooking for a longer duration.
  • If you want to cook the fish sticks from thawed instead of frozen, that's possible, but adjust the cooking time as they will cook faster.

Cook for 9-10 minutes

To cook fish sticks in an air fryer, preheat your air fryer to 400 degrees Fahrenheit. Place the frozen fish sticks in the air fryer basket or tray in a single layer, ensuring they do not overlap. This allows the hot air to circulate and cook the fish sticks evenly.

Cook the fish sticks for 9-10 minutes at 400 degrees Fahrenheit. Flip the fish sticks halfway through the cooking process, around the 4-6 minute mark. You can shake the air fryer basket to flip the fish sticks, or use tongs.

At the 9-10 minute mark, the fish sticks should be warmed through and crispy and golden. Remove the fish sticks from the air fryer and serve.

Note that cooking time may vary depending on the air fryer model and wattage, so it is important to keep an eye on the fish sticks to ensure they do not overcook. Check on them 2-3 minutes before the time is up and adjust the recipe as needed.
